South Africa gets first electric minibus taxi amid high EV import tax

A consortium led by fleet management solutions provider GoMetro has launched South Africa’s first electric minibus taxi despite a high EV import tax. The price of the minibus will range from R1.1 million ($63,413) to R1.2 million ($69,178).

Uber launches Uber Safari in South Africa for $200

Uber, a ride-hailing company, has launched Uber Safari in South Africa, from Cape Town to the Aquila Private Game Reserve. The offering will be available from October 2024 to February 2025, running on Fridays and Saturdays at a flat fee of $200 (over R3,000).

Chinese BYD expands into Zambia

Chinese electric vehicle manufacturer Build Your Dreams (BYD) has expanded into Zambia, selling three models in the country: Dolphin, ATTO 3, and SEAL. The BYD Zambia showroom is scheduled to launch on September 5, 2024.

Uber’s Q2 global gross bookings hit $40 billion, expects $41.75 billion in Q3

Uber, operating in 61 cities across seven countries in sub-Saharan Africa, reported $40 billion in gross bookings for Q2 2024. Revenue increased by 16%, with income from operations at $796 million.
